Biology (General)

BS

The Bachelor of Science (BS) in Biology program is designed to allow students to obtain the comprehensive, solid knowledge in biological sciences. General biology is one of three (3) available focus areas.

  • General Biology: This focus area prepares students for a variety of careers such as conservation biologists, environmental site assessment scientists, government employee, biological graduate programs at universities, lab technicians in hospitals and research centers, high school teachers of biology/science, technical sales/ service representatives, and more.
